Bagikan melalui


Location Kelas

Definisi

Mewakili lokasi fisik dengan informasi lintang, bujur, ketinggian, dan waktu yang dilaporkan oleh perangkat.

public ref class Location
public class Location
type Location = class
Public Class Location
Warisan
Location

Konstruktor

Location()

Menginisialisasi instans baru kelas Location.

Location(Double, Double)

Menginisialisasi instans Location baru kelas dengan garis lintang dan bujur yang ditentukan.

Location(Double, Double, DateTimeOffset)

Menginisialisasi instans Location baru kelas dengan garis lintang, bujur, dan tanda waktu yang ditentukan.

Location(Double, Double, Double)

Menginisialisasi instans Location baru kelas dengan garis lintang, bujur, dan ketinggian yang ditentukan.

Location(Location)

Menginisialisasi instans Location baru kelas dari instans yang ada.

Properti

Accuracy

Mendapatkan atau mengatur akurasi horizontal (dalam meter) lokasi.

Altitude

Mendapatkan ketinggian dalam meter (jika tersedia) dalam sistem referensi yang ditentukan oleh AltitudeReferenceSystem.

AltitudeReferenceSystem

Menentukan sistem referensi tempat Altitude nilai dinyatakan.

Course

Mendapatkan atau mengatur derajat saat ini relatif terhadap utara sejati pada saat lokasi ini ditentukan.

IsFromMockProvider

Mendapatkan atau mengatur apakah lokasi ini berasal dari sensor yang ditiru dan dengan demikian mungkin bukan lokasi perangkat yang sebenarnya.

Latitude

Mendapatkan atau mengatur koordinat lintang lokasi ini.

Longitude

Mendapatkan atau mengatur koordinat bujur lokasi ini.

ReducedAccuracy

Mendapatkan atau mengatur apakah lokasi ini memiliki pengurangan akurasi pembacaan.

Speed

Mendapatkan atau mengatur kecepatan saat ini dalam meter per detik pada saat lokasi ini ditentukan.

Timestamp

Mendapatkan atau mengatur tanda waktu lokasi di UTC.

VerticalAccuracy

Mendapatkan atau mengatur akurasi vertikal (dalam meter) lokasi.

Metode

CalculateDistance(Double, Double, Double, Double, DistanceUnits)

Hitung jarak antara dua Location instans.

CalculateDistance(Double, Double, Location, DistanceUnits)

Hitung jarak antara dua lokasi.

CalculateDistance(Location, Double, Double, DistanceUnits)

Hitung jarak antara dua lokasi.

CalculateDistance(Location, Location, DistanceUnits)

Hitung jarak antara dua lokasi.

Equals(Object)

Mewakili lokasi fisik dengan informasi lintang, bujur, ketinggian, dan waktu yang dilaporkan oleh perangkat.

GetHashCode()

Mewakili lokasi fisik dengan informasi lintang, bujur, ketinggian, dan waktu yang dilaporkan oleh perangkat.

ToString()

Mengembalikan representasi string dari nilai saat ini dari Location.

Operator

Equality(Location, Location)

Operator kesetaraan untuk sama.

Inequality(Location, Location)

Operator ketidaksamaan.

Metode Ekstensi

CalculateDistance(Location, Location, DistanceUnits)

Ekstensi untuk menghitung jarak dari lokasi ke lokasi lain.

CalculateDistance(Location, Double, Double, DistanceUnits)

Ekstensi untuk menghitung jarak dari lokasi ke lokasi lain.

OpenMapsAsync(Location)

Buka peta ke lokasi ini.

OpenMapsAsync(Location, MapLaunchOptions)

Buka peta ke lokasi ini.

Berlaku untuk